当前位置: 代码迷 >> Java Web开发 >> window.location.href = "sendMsg.jsp?checkDate=" + 一; 不执行。
  详细解决方案

window.location.href = "sendMsg.jsp?checkDate=" + 一; 不执行。

热度:780   发布时间:2016-04-17 12:17:14.0
window.location.href = "sendMsg.jsp?checkDate=" + 1; 不执行。。。。。
<%@ page language="java" contentType="text/html; charset=UTF-8"%>
<%@ page import="com.macchy.m2.server.plugin.bbs.*"
contentType="text/html; charset=UTF-8"%>
<html>
 <head>
  <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
  <script language="javaScript" src="js/sendBbs.js"></script>  
 </head>
<%
//title
final String TITLE = "txttitle";
//content
final String CONTENT = "txtcontent";
//session user
final String SESSINOUSER = "sessionUser";
//sessin group
final String SESSIONGROUP = "sessionGroup";
//session NickName
  final String SESSIONNICKNAME = "sessionNickName";
  //sessin WidgetName
  final String SESSIONWIDGETNAME = "sessionWidgetName";
//empty
final String EMPTY = "";
//title
String title = "";
//content
String content = "";
//user
String user = "";
//groupName
String groupName = "";
//nickName
String nickName = "";
//widgetName
String widgetName = "";
SmartUpload su = new SmartUpload();
try {
su.setCharset("UTF-8");
su.initialize(pageContext);
su.setMaxFileSize(1000000000);
su.setTotalMaxFileSize(20000000);
su.setAllowedFilesList("doc,txt,java,jpg,png,zip,pdf,rar,jar,html,jsp,xls,mp3,gif");
su.setDeniedFilesList("exe,mid,waw,bat,htm");
su.upload();
} catch (Exception e) {
response.sendRedirect("sendMsg.jsp?checkDate=" + 4);
return;
}
//post title get
title = su.getRequest().getParameter(TITLE);
// post content get
content = su.getRequest().getParameter(CONTENT);
// session user get
user = (String) session.getAttribute(SESSINOUSER);
// session group get
groupName = (String) session.getAttribute(SESSIONGROUP);
  //session nickName get
nickName = (String) session.getAttribute(SESSIONNICKNAME);
// session nickName get
widgetName = (String) session.getAttribute(SESSIONWIDGETNAME);
if(title.equals(EMPTY) && !content.equals(EMPTY)) {
  %>
<script type="text/javascript">
window.location.href = "sendMsg.jsp?checkDate=" + 1;
</script>
  <%
} else if (!title.equals(EMPTY) && content.equals(EMPTY)) {
response.sendRedirect("sendMsg.jsp?checkDate=" + 2);
return;
} else if (title.equals(EMPTY ) && content.equals(EMPTY)) {
response.sendRedirect("sendMsg.jsp?checkDate=" + 3);
return;
}
String fileName = su.getFileName();
BbsSendData send = new BbsSendData();
String filePath = send.doPost(title, content, user, groupName, fileName, nickName, widgetName);
if(fileName != null || !fileName.equals(EMPTY)) {
su.save(filePath);
}
response.sendRedirect("showMsg.jsp");
%>
</html>

window.location.href = "sendMsg.jsp?checkDate=" + 1;
不执行。。。。
如何解决

------解决方案--------------------
HTML code
if(title.equals(EMPTY) && !content.equals(EMPTY)) {       %>       <script type="text/javascript">           window.location.href = "sendMsg.jsp?checkDate=" + 1;       </script>       <% }
------解决方案--------------------
  相关解决方案